Trademark Overview


On Tuesday, August 5, 1997, a trademark application was filed for THE MAINE MAN with the United States Patent and Trademark Office. The USPTO has given the THE MAINE MAN trademark a serial number of 75336278. The federal status of this trademark filing is ABANDONED - FAILURE TO RESPOND OR LATE RESPONSE as of Monday, January 18, 1999. This trademark is owned by Camp & Associates, Inc.. The THE MAINE MAN trademark is filed in the Computer & Software Products & Electrical & Scientific Products, Jewelry Products, Paper & Printed Material Products, Furniture Products, Houseware & Glass Products, and Toys & Sporting Goods Products categories with the following description:

sunglasses

jewelry, watches, and clocks

paper goods and printed materials, such as brochures and books directed to automobile racing, posters, stickers, decals, calendars and cards

diverse, various, and sundry miscellaneous promotional and merchandizing items, including but not limited to, metal goods, such as key rings and metal license plates

housewares and glass products, such as drinking glasses, cups and mugs; rubber, plastic or foam insulating beverage holders; water bottles sold empty

toys and sporting goods, such as miniature cars and trucks
